Notes
The man that took part in the Ceremonial First Pitch Marriage Proposal got Kakunaka to whiff, which "green lighted" the marriage to his fiance. ... A youth baseball team from Sendai (a group of thirty-five elementary school kids) watched the game from the 319 Seats (sponsored by Saburo and Karakawa).
HR: ORI: Scales (3, one on, off S. Watanabe). LOT: Nemoto (5, one on, off Yoshino).
Orix: Yoshino got the loss in relief and is 2-1 in thirty-one games. ... Lee's hitting streak ended at thirteen games. ... Adachi collected his first Ichi-gun RBI on sac fly in the 2nd and hit in the 6th. ... The Buffaloes are the first team in the PL to lose forty games this season.
Lotte: S. Watanabe made his eleventh start of the year and had his shortest outing of the season. ... Otani got the win in relief and is 1-2 in twenty games. This was his first victory since August 10, 2011 (vs Softbank). ... Uchi recorded his fourth save of the year.
